Primary Function of Position:
This position is responsible for maintaining the integrity of the content of the Clarity PPM Database by performing in-depth investigations of questionable data entry and correcting as appropriate or advised. The Data Integrity Specialist provides issue identification, assessment, resolution, and technical support to achieve desired outcomes and compliance with Intuitive's policies / procedures and service level agreements. This role analyzes data correction scenarios and performs subsequent hands-on technical data corrections as part of daily work responsibilities. This position serves as an organizational resource for issues involving Clarity PPM data base project/milestone data correction and instructional support. The individual coordinates the parties and interdisciplinary teams involved in each case (i.e., finance, HR, PMO) and is responsible for ensuring all necessary corrections are made in a timely manner.
Roles & Responsibilities:
- Monitoring and reviewing data for integrity across Clarity PPM, data warehouse and Tableau dashboards
- This person would be responsible for the accurate entry of data into Clarity PPM
- Needs to work with mainly Finance and HR to collect important data about new hires and enter in the Clarity PPM system to support the quarterly resource allocation cycles
- Integrating best practices in data collection and management to guarantee quality assurance
- Performing data cleansing procedures as needed
- Effectively supports the migration of legacy data (in spreadsheets and databases) into new information systems as needed
- Creates data exports and reports in response to requests for information
- Provides end user instruction and support in finding and using data for organizational needs
- Completes additional projects as assigned
